Position Summary:

Support clerical, administrative, secretarial, functions for a very busy medical office.

What you will do:

  • Check in/Check out

  • Answering multiple phone lines

  • Scheduling appointments

  • Manage Referrals

  • Insurance verification

  • Other clerical functions

What you need:

  • Education and/or training as medical secretary, medical receptionist, medical assistant preferred

  • Or high school graduate/ GED required

  • Associates degree in a medical related concentration preferred
